Assad will be responsible for finding new opportunities for the company and sell its Apollo Acre turnkey solution to commercial-scale solar farms in Lebanon, Tunisia, Kuwait, Cuba and Panama.
After announcing Assad’s appointment, Solamon’s president Jay Yeo said the company would soon disclose information about new projects and voiced optimism for a series of potential deals in the Middle East for utility-scale solar plants in more than one country.
